CVE-2007-3189 1 Jffnms 1 Just For Fun Network Management System 2018-10-16 4.3 MEDIUM N/A
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in auth.php in Just For Fun Network Management System (JFFNMS) 0.8.3 all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via the user parameter.
CVE-2007-3190 1 Jffnms 1 Just For Fun Network Management System 2018-10-16 6.8 MEDIUM N/A
Multiple SQL injection vulnerabilities in auth.php in Just For Fun Network Management System (JFFNMS) 0.8.3, when magic_quotes_gpc is disabled, allow remote attackers to execute arbitrary SQL commands via the (1) user and (2) pass parameters.
CVE-2007-3191 1 Jffnms 1 Just For Fun Network Management System 2018-10-16 9.4 HIGH N/A
Just For Fun Network Management System (JFFNMS) 0.8.3 allows remote attackers to obtain configuration information via a direct request to admin/adm/test.php, which calls the phpinfo function.
CVE-2007-3192 1 Jffnms 1 Just For Fun Network Management System 2018-10-16 9.4 HIGH N/A
admin/setup.php in Just For Fun Network Management System (JFFNMS) 0.8.3 allows remote attackers to read and modify configuration settings via a direct request.
CVE-2007-3204 1 Jffnms 1 Just For Fun Network Management System 2017-07-28 7.5 HIGH N/A
SQL injection vulnerability in auth.php in Just For Fun Network Management System (JFFNMS) 0.8.4-pre2 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ary SQL commands via the pass parameter. NOTE: this issue reportedly exists because of an initial incomplete fix for CVE-2007-3190. The provenance of this information is unknown; the details are obtained solely from third party information.
